Expanding its European efforts, Bragg Gaming has formed a content partnership to provide its igaming releases to Swiss operator Casino Du Lac Meyrin.

Under the terms of the deal, Bragg will supply a curated range of igaming titles to Pasino.ch, Casino Du Lac Meyrin’s online casino brand. 

While the supplier’s offering has yet to be disclosed, it may include slots from Bragg’s in-house studios such as Atomic Slot Lab and Indigo Magic. 

Lara Falzon, President and Chief Operating Officer at Bragg Gaming Group, stated: “The Swiss market is showing great signs of growth and through this partnership with Groupe Partouche, we significantly strengthen our presence in the country, again with a major operator.

“The relationship is an important part of our growth strategy for 2023 which will see us further expand our global geographical reach with established names such as Groupe Partouche.”

The collaboration comes shortly after Bragg Gaming formed a similar partnership in Switzerland, forming a deal with Grand Casino Basel to supply its online casino brand Golden Grand with a range of slot releases. 

Rupert Ecker, Managing Director at Pasino.ch, added: “Bragg’s collection of games brings great entertainment to our players and is a valuable addition to our licensed Swiss online casino. 

“Staying competitive through a wide and constantly growing offering is crucial to us, and Bragg provides proven titles that will ensure we stay ahead of the game.”
